From July 19, double-jabbed Britons have been able to travel to amber list countries without having to quarantine upon their return back to the UK. However, just days before the relaxed rule came into place, the Government announced plans to extend the amber list with a new “amber plus list”.
Jet2
Jet2 has not made any immediate amendments to its itinerary as a result of the new rule change.
However, the Leeds-based airline has been ramping up its holiday in recent months.
In order to help passengers understand restrictions in place for certain destinations, Jet2 has created its own Traffic Light update.
Jet2 states: “As the UK Government has previously decided not to give us advance notice of any changes to the entry requirements from different countries, please bear with us as we need to take time to consider any changes to our programme and policies.”
It continues: “Following the UK Government announcement about fully vaccinated travellers no longer having to self-isolate when returning to the UK from Amber List countries, we’ll be taking off to our Amber List destinations from July 19, 2021. Please check the travel requirements for your destination.
“We’ll review the status of Amber List destinations following the next UK Government update which we expect to be on or around August 5, 2021.
“If you’re due to depart on or before August 11, 2021, and you’re not fully vaccinated, if you want to, you can amend your booking admin-fee-free or cancel with a full refund.”
Jet2 assures it will contact customers if their booking is “affected in any way”.
